Ball State cruises early, struggles late, gets beat by Morehead State

Ball State came out with a good defensive game plan in the first half against Morehead State, taking a 25-15 lead at halftime. The Cardinals stretched the lead to 11 a few minutes into the second half at 28-17. Over the next 10 minutes, Morehead went on a 20-4 run to take a 37-32 lead. During those 10 minutes BSU was 1-of-9 from the field, 2-of-4 from the free throw line, and had 4 turnovers.

Ball State cut the lead to one, 45-44, at the 4-minute timeout. The next Morehead possession put the momentum in the Eagles hands. Drew Kelly hit a three-pointer and BSU's Malik Perry fouled one of the forwards for Morehead, leading to an eventual 5-point possession that pushed the lead to 50-44. BSU clamped down the D after that as Morehead did not score the rest of the game. BSU's Randy Davis hit four free throws in the last two minutes to cut the lead to 50-48 and the Cardinals had the ball with 12 seconds to go. Davis drove to the hoop and missed a reverse layup as time expired to give the Eagles a 50-48 victory.

The loss snaps BSU's 7 game winning streak, bringing their record to 13-5. They host Kent State on Thursday and Ohio on Saturday as they start their MAC East schedule.
